About agriculture in Ludźmierz
Ludźmierz is located in the Podhale region of the Lesser Poland Voivodeship, near the town of Nowy Targ. The surrounding area is characterized by a picturesque mountain landscape with rolling hills and lush green pastures at the foot of the Tatra Mountains. The rural scenery is dominated by traditional wooden architecture and vast meadows that define the unique highland atmosphere of this part of southern Poland.
Agriculture in the vicinity of Ludźmierz focuses primarily on livestock farming due to the challenging mountainous terrain. Cattle and sheep breeding are the most prominent activities, with a strong emphasis on dairy production and traditional sheep grazing in high-altitude pastures. Farmers also cultivate hardy crops such as potatoes and grains like rye or oats, which are well-suited to the local climate and highland soil conditions.
Agronomists and farm workers visiting the area can find opportunities mainly in small and medium-sized family farms. Seasonal demand is often linked to the harvest of mountain hay and the management of livestock during the grazing season from spring to autumn. The local agricultural sector values traditional methods combined with modern quality standards, offering a unique environment for those interested in highland farming and artisanal food production.
